BVD, that's a thought and not uncommon to hear, thanks for bringing it up. Let me share with everyone why we are having such success with the design. Some of this may resonate with readers.

A few years ago I obtained my FFL03, well long story short I ran out of space in my safe. I went on a search for handgun racks that enabled me to safely store my guns in a manner that allowed:

- Maximum density in the safe
- The ability to move guns as group from the safe to my bench or other location
- Protection of the finish
- Security (sometimes at the range or a show)
- The ability to keep matching mags etc near the gun

I found that every thing on the market did not meet one or more of the points above. I found that the wood racks were heavy, very large and did not enable me to easily grab the rack and take it over to my bench. The metal racks were very unstable and tend to have the guns flop around and mar the finish.

I came up with the Armory Racks design and have been using them for about 2 years now. By hanging the guns by the barrel you not only enable maximum density, but you don't damage the finish inside or out. I could also add a tray under the rack to store accessories. I could easily move guns around to work on them or just look at my collection outside of the safe. The pic below shows you how you can fit 48 handguns on 6 Armory Racks in 16 1/2" of space.

The hangers themselves were tested a lot. To ensure that that you can't damage the barrel or crown we have powder coated the hangers and added a plastic cap as well. The materials chosen do not absorb moisture either so you have great air circulation around the entire gun.

At the end of the day, everyone will find a solution that works best for them, what was on the market did not work for me. After several people asked to buy my racks, I decided to start a small business and offer them to others. We also now offer additional protection for the barrel.
